Joy (Varteresian) Kelliher, 87, passed away peacefully on Tuesday, March 15, 2022. She was predeceased by her husband of 60 years, John B. Kelliher II. 

She is survived by her three children and six grandchildren, Debra McCarthy and her husband Jack of Estero, FL, and their two children, Taylor and husband Michael Catalina of Vernon, CT and Conor of Webster; John B. Kelliher lll and his wife Lori of Sandwich, and their two children, John B Kelliher IV and wife Kirsti of Myrtle Beach, SC., and Daniel of Sandwich; Eric Kelliher and his partner Kim Chilingirian of Salisbury, MA, and his two children Grace and Thomas of Shrewsbury.  She was predeceased by her daughter Christine E. Kelliher and siblings, Varteras Varteresian, Anna Hagopian, Ethel Asadoorian, and Alice Garabedian.  Auntie Joy will be greatly missed by her many nieces and nephews.

Born in Newton on December 24, 1934, she was the daughter of Maderos and Ogenie (Harangi) Varteresian.  Joy lived in Auburn for the past 6 years, previously living in Centerville and Whitinsville.  She was a graduate of Northbridge Public Schools, and started her career in finance at the Credit Union in the Whitin Machine Works, before moving to Cape Cod with her husband in 1979.  She worked for Cape Cod Anesthesia Assoc. and was the bookkeeper for the family-owned business, New Village Square Realty Trust, in Sandwich before her retirement. 

Joy and her husband Jack loved spending time on Cape Cod beaches, taking in many sunsets.  She enjoyed traveling with her family.  Some of her favorite vacations destinations included - the Caribbean, Florida, Hawaii and the White Mountains of New Hampshire.  Her grandchildren will cherish the many memories of their overnight stays at “Grammy’s House”.   She enjoyed quilting and crocheting with her friends, but her true love was cooking, especially for holiday gatherings.  She was a member of St. Patrick’s Parish in Whitinsville and Our Lady of Victory Parish in Centerville, where she was a devoted member of the Friday Grandmother’s Prayer Group.
